Flovagatran

Flovagatran (TGN 255) is a potent and reversible thrombin inhibitor (Ki: 9 nM). Flovagatran can be used in the research of arterial and venous thrombosis[1].

[In Vivo]
Flovagatran (2.5-mg/kg bolus plus 10 mg/kg/h for 90 minutes) produces anticoagulation effects in dogs[1]. Animal Model: Chicks[1] Dosage: 1.0-mg/kg bolus and then 4 mg/kg/h for 90 minutes. 2.5-mg/kg bolus and then 10 mg/kg/h for 90 minutes. 5.0-mg/kg bolus and then 20 mg/kg/h for 90 minutes. Administration: Bolus plus infusion Result: Elevated PD markers, and produced minimal post-operative blood loss.
